What is ISF?

Before we dive into the role of freight forwarders in ISF, let’s first understand what ISF is and why it is necessary for importing goods into the United States.

The Importer Security Filing, also known as ISF or 10+2, is a mandatory filing requirement by U.S. Customs and Border Protection (CBP) for ocean cargo arriving into the United States. ISF was implemented to enhance cargo security and enable CBP to better assess and mitigate potential risks associated with imported goods.

Why is ISF Important?

ISF is essential for several reasons. Firstly, it enhances cargo security by providing CBP with advance information about incoming shipments, allowing them to identify potential high-risk cargo. Secondly, ISF helps prevent smuggling, terrorism, and other illicit activities by ensuring that all imported goods are properly documented and accounted for. Lastly, ISF streamlines the import process by reducing delays and improving the flow of goods through U.S. ports.

The Role of Freight Forwarders in ISF

Now that we have covered the basics of ISF, let’s delve into the specific role that freight forwarders play in the ISF process. Freight forwarders are intermediaries between importers and carriers, coordinating the shipment of goods from origin to destination. In the context of ISF, freight forwarders are responsible for ensuring that the ISF is filed accurately and in a timely manner on behalf of the importer.

Responsibilities of Freight Forwarders in ISF

Freight forwarders have several key responsibilities when it comes to ISF. Some of the main responsibilities include:

  • Collecting and verifying ISF information from the importer
  • Submitting the ISF to CBP before the cargo is loaded onto the vessel
  • Communicating any changes or updates to the ISF to CBP in a timely manner
  • Resolving any ISF-related issues or discrepancies that may arise during the import process

Freight forwarders play a crucial role in ensuring that the ISF is filed correctly and that all required information is provided to CBP to facilitate the smooth importation of goods.

Importance of Accurate ISF Filing

Accurate ISF filing is crucial for several reasons. Firstly, inaccurate or incomplete ISF filings can result in costly penalties from CBP, delays in cargo clearance, and potential seizure of goods. Secondly, accurate ISF filing helps CBP identify high-risk cargo and enables them to allocate resources more effectively to mitigate security risks. Lastly, accurate ISF filing is essential for maintaining compliance with CBP regulations and avoiding any potential legal issues.

Common Challenges Faced by Freight Forwarders in ISF

Despite the importance of accurate ISF filing, freight forwarders often face several challenges in the ISF process. Some common challenges include:

  • Lack of timely and accurate information from importers
  • Changes or updates to shipment details after the ISF has been filed
  • Technical issues with filing systems or software
  • Communication barriers with CBP or other stakeholders

Best Practices for Freight Forwarders in ISF

To help freight forwarders navigate the complexities of ISF effectively, here are some best practices to keep in mind:

  • Establish clear communication channels with importers to ensure timely and accurate submission of ISF information
  • Stay informed about any updates or changes to ISF requirements and regulations
  • Use reliable filing systems and software to submit ISF accurately and efficiently
  • Maintain detailed records of ISF filings and communications with CBP for future reference
  • Collaborate with other stakeholders, such as customs brokers and carriers, to streamline the ISF process

By following these best practices, freight forwarders can improve their ISF filing processes, enhance compliance, and ensure smooth import operations for their clients.
